MORANG: Uddhav Thapa has been elected as the leader of the Nepali Congress Province-1 parliamentary party (PP).

Thapa, who is close to NC leader Krishna Prasad SItaula, garnered 18 votes

Kedar Karki who contested with Thapa got 9 votes and Amrit Aryal got 2 votes. Nepali Congress has 29 MPs in the state assembly.

According to the NC statute, a leader should get 51 percent of the votes to get elected as the PP leader, which means that the PP leader should garner 15 out of 29 votes in today’s election.
